34 // - Directories should be searched in the following order: ~/.q3a/baseq3,
35 // install dir (/usr/local/games/quake3/baseq3) and cd_path (/mnt/cdrom/baseq3).
37 // - Pak files are searched first inside the directories.
38 // - Case insensitive.
39 // - Unix-style slashes (/) (windows is backwards .. everyone knows that)

249 This behaves identically to stricmp(a,b), except that ASCII chars
250 [\]^`_ come AFTER alphabet chars instead of before. This is because
251 it converts all alphabet chars to uppercase before comparison,
252 while stricmp converts them to lowercase.

276 // Arnout: note - sort pakfiles in reverse order. This ensures that
277 // later pakfiles override earlier ones. This because the vfs module
278 // returns a filehandle to the first file it can find (while it should
279 // return the filehandle to the file in the most overriding pakfile, the
280 // last one in the list that is).
